读写多怎么使用redis

不及物动词 其他 18

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要使用Redis进行读写操作,需要先安装Redis并熟悉其命令和使用方法。下面是使用Redis进行读写的一般步骤:

    1. 安装Redis:可以在Redis官网(https://redis.io/download)上下载最新版本的Redis,并按照官方文档进行安装。

    2. 启动Redis服务器:安装完成后,可以使用命令redis-server来启动Redis服务器。默认情况下,Redis会监听在本地的6379端口。

    3. 连接到Redis服务器:使用redis-cli命令来连接到运行中的Redis服务器。默认情况下,该命令会连接到本地的6379端口。

    4. 写入数据:可以使用SET命令来向Redis中写入数据。例如,使用SET key value命令可以将指定的键值对存储到Redis中。

    5. 读取数据:可以使用GET命令来从Redis中读取数据。例如,使用GET key命令可以获取指定键的值。

    6. 使用其他写入命令:除了SET命令外,Redis还提供了其他写入命令,例如HSET用于存储哈希类型的数据,LPUSH用于存储列表类型的数据,SADD用于存储集合类型的数据等等。

    7. 使用其他读取命令:除了GET命令外,Redis还提供了其他读取命令,例如HGET用于获取哈希类型数据中指定字段的值,LRANGE用于获取列表类型数据的元素列表,SMEMBERS用于获取集合类型数据的所有成员等等。

    8. 关闭与Redis的连接:在使用完Redis后,可以使用QUIT命令来关闭与Redis的连接,或者直接使用Ctrl+C来终止Redis客户端。

    以上是使用Redis进行读写操作的一般步骤,具体的使用方法还可以参考Redis的官方文档或者相关教程。在实际应用中,还可以利用Redis的其他特性,例如事务、发布订阅、持久化等,来满足更复杂的需求。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Redis是一种内存数据库,支持读写操作,可以用于实现高性能的数据存储和访问。使用Redis进行读写操作可以通过以下几个步骤:

    1. 安装和配置Redis:首先需要安装Redis服务器,可从Redis官方网站下载安装包,根据操作系统类型选择适合的版本进行安装。安装完成后,需要进行一些基本的配置,如指定端口号、设置密码等。

    2. 连接Redis:在读写数据之前,需要建立与Redis服务器的连接。可以使用Redis的客户端工具,如redis-cli、Redis Desktop Manager等,通过指定服务器地址和端口号以及身份验证信息进行连接。

    3. 写入数据:写入数据是指将数据存储到Redis中。使用Redis的SET命令可以向Redis中的数据结构(如字符串、哈希、列表等)写入数据。具体写入的方式取决于数据结构的不同,例如使用SET命令写入字符串数据,HMSET命令写入哈希数据,LPUSH命令写入列表数据等。

    4. 读取数据:读取数据是指从Redis中获取数据。根据数据结构的不同,可以使用不同的命令来读取数据。例如,使用GET命令读取字符串数据,HGETALL命令读取哈希数据,LRANGE命令读取列表数据等。读取数据时可以根据需要指定读取的范围、过滤条件等。

    5. 更新和删除数据:除了写入和读取数据,还可以使用Redis提供的命令来更新和删除已有的数据。例如,使用SET命令可以更新字符串数据,HSET命令可以更新哈希数据的某个字段,DEL命令可以删除指定的数据等。

    6. 使用事务和管道:Redis支持事务和管道操作,可以提高读写性能。事务是指将一系列的命令包装成一个原子操作,一次性执行,保证操作的一致性。管道是指将多个命令一次性发送到Redis服务器执行,减少网络通信开销。通过使用事务和管道,可以将多个读写操作进行批处理,提高系统的处理能力。

    总结起来,使用Redis进行读写操作需要安装和配置Redis服务器,建立连接,然后使用相应的命令进行数据的写入、读取、更新和删除。此外,还可以使用事务和管道操作来提高读写性能。在实际使用中,还需要根据具体的业务需求和数据结构的特点进行合理的选择和优化。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    使用Redis进行读写操作可以分为以下几个步骤:

    1. 安装和配置Redis:
      首先,需要在服务器上安装并配置Redis。可以前往Redis官方网站下载安装包并按照官方文档进行安装配置。

    2. 连接Redis:
      在应用程序中,需要使用Redis提供的连接客户端与Redis服务器建立连接。根据使用的编程语言的不同,可以选择对应语言的Redis客户端包进行安装。

    3. 写入数据到Redis:
      使用Redis提供的指令(命令)将需要写入的数据存储到Redis中。以下是一些常用的Redis写指令:

      • SET:设置一个键值对。
      • HSET:设置一个哈希表中的字段和值。
      • LPUSH:将一个或多个值插入到列表的左侧。
      • RPUSH:将一个或多个值插入到列表的右侧。
      • SADD:将一个或多个成员添加到集合中。
      • ZADD:将一个或多个成员及其分数添加到有序集合中。

      使用这些指令可以根据需求将数据写入到Redis中。

    4. 从Redis读取数据:
      使用Redis提供的指令(命令)从Redis中读取数据。以下是一些常用的Redis读指令:

      • GET:获取指定键的值。
      • HGET:获取指定哈希表中的字段值。
      • LRANGE:获取列表中的指定范围的值。
      • SMEMBERS:获取集合中的所有成员。
      • ZRANGE:获取有序集合中指定范围内的成员。

      根据需要使用这些指令从Redis中读取数据。

    5. 批量写入数据到Redis:
      如果需要批量写入数据到Redis,可以使用Redis提供的事务功能或管道功能。

      • 事务:通过MULTI指令开启事务,然后按顺序执行多个指令,最后使用EXEC指令提交事务。如果在执行事务期间有错误发生,可以使用DISCARD指令放弃事务。
      • 管道:通过使用管道可以减少通信次数从而提高写入效率。在管道中可以提交多个写入指令,然后通过执行管道指令一次性发送给Redis服务器。
    6. 数据持久化:
      Redis支持两种方式的数据持久化:RDB快照和AOF日志。RDB快照是一种将Redis数据完整保存到磁盘的机制,AOF日志记录了对Redis服务器的写操作,以便在重启后重新执行这些写操作以恢复数据。

    以上是使用Redis进行读写操作的一般步骤和方法。根据具体需求,可以结合使用不同的指令或功能来实现更灵活的读写操作。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部